What the Data Says About Somerset Raritan Valley Sewerage Authority
The federal enforcement record for Somerset Raritan Valley Sewerage Authority in Bridgewater, NJ includes 2 OSHA inspections and 7 violations, translating to 3.50 violations per inspection. Of those violations, 7 (100.0%) were classified as serious, 0 (0.0%) as willful, and 0 (0.0%) as repeat. Serious violations denote hazards likely to cause death or serious physical harm; willful and repeat categories indicate intentional disregard or recurrence of previously cited hazards.
OSHA assessed $34,300 in initial penalties against this employer, later adjusted to a current total of $34,300 - no reduction from the original assessment. Average penalty per inspection works out to $17,150. Against the Utilities industry average of $5,434 per employer, this record runs far above peers (6.3x the sector average).
Inspection activity spans from 2026-04-20 to 2026-05-05, a window of roughly 1 year.
